Should he be able to drink this much?
txaggiemom replied to txaggiemom's topic in POST-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
Thanks everyone for your replies. I saw so many people that said that they weren't able to drink as much and I was really worried. I am going to try sipping though. -
Should he be able to drink this much?
txaggiemom posted a topic in POST-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
I am 7 days out and on full liquids. I am able to do 2 ounces of "calorie" liquids per hour along with the 2 ounces of Water or water or water substitutes, but I can just keep on drinking water all the time and have no problem with getting full or vomitting. I am worried there is something wrong or that I am messing up my sleeve -
